1,323 research outputs found

    Efficient hierarchical approximation of high-dimensional option pricing problems

    Get PDF
    A major challenge in computational finance is the pricing of options that depend on a large number of risk factors. Prominent examples are basket or index options where dozens or even hundreds of stocks constitute the underlying asset and determine the dimensionality of the corresponding degenerate parabolic equation. The objective of this article is to show how an efficient discretisation can be achieved by hierarchical approximation as well as asymptotic expansions of the underlying continuous problem. The relation to a number of state-of-the-art methods is highlighted

    A multigrid platform for real-time motion computation with discontinuity-preserving variational methods

    Get PDF
    Variational methods are among the most accurate techniques for estimating the optic flow. They yield dense flow fields and can be designed such that they preserve discontinuities, allow to deal with large displacements and perform well under noise or varying illumination. However, such adaptations render the minimisation of the underlying energy functional very expensive in terms of computational costs: Typically, one or more large linear or nonlinear systems of equations have to be solved in order to obtain the desired solution. Consequently, variational methods are considered to be too slow for real-time performance. In our paper we address this problem in two ways: (i) We present a numerical framework based on bidirectional multigrid methods for accelerating a broad class of variational optic flow methods with different constancy and smoothness assumptions. In particular, discontinuity-preserving regularisation strategies are thereby in the focus of our work. (ii) We show by the examples of classical as well as more advanced variational techniques that real-time performance is possible - even for very complex optic flow models with high accuracy. Experiments show frame rates up to 63 dense flow fields per second for real-world image sequences of size 160 x 120 on a standard PC. Compared to classical iterative methods this constitutes a speedup of two to four orders of magnitude

    Adaptive control in rollforward recovery for extreme scale multigrid

    Full text link
    With the increasing number of compute components, failures in future exa-scale computer systems are expected to become more frequent. This motivates the study of novel resilience techniques. Here, we extend a recently proposed algorithm-based recovery method for multigrid iterations by introducing an adaptive control. After a fault, the healthy part of the system continues the iterative solution process, while the solution in the faulty domain is re-constructed by an asynchronous on-line recovery. The computations in both the faulty and healthy subdomains must be coordinated in a sensitive way, in particular, both under and over-solving must be avoided. Both of these waste computational resources and will therefore increase the overall time-to-solution. To control the local recovery and guarantee an optimal re-coupling, we introduce a stopping criterion based on a mathematical error estimator. It involves hierarchical weighted sums of residuals within the context of uniformly refined meshes and is well-suited in the context of parallel high-performance computing. The re-coupling process is steered by local contributions of the error estimator. We propose and compare two criteria which differ in their weights. Failure scenarios when solving up to 6.9â‹…10116.9\cdot10^{11} unknowns on more than 245\,766 parallel processes will be reported on a state-of-the-art peta-scale supercomputer demonstrating the robustness of the method

    Computing the force distribution on the surface of complex, deforming geometries using vortex methods and Brinkman penalization

    Full text link
    The distribution of forces on the surface of complex, deforming geometries is an invaluable output of flow simulations. One particular example of such geometries involves self-propelled swimmers. Surface forces can provide significant information about the flow field sensed by the swimmers, and are difficult to obtain experimentally. At the same time, simulations of flow around complex, deforming shapes can be computationally prohibitive when body-fitted grids are used. Alternatively, such simulations may employ penalization techniques. Penalization methods rely on simple Cartesian grids to discretize the governing equations, which are enhanced by a penalty term to account for the boundary conditions. They have been shown to provide a robust estimation of mean quantities, such as drag and propulsion velocity, but the computation of surface force distribution remains a challenge. We present a method for determining flow- induced forces on the surface of both rigid and deforming bodies, in simulations using re-meshed vortex methods and Brinkman penalization. The pressure field is recovered from the velocity by solving a Poisson's equation using the Green's function approach, augmented with a fast multipole expansion and a tree- code algorithm. The viscous forces are determined by evaluating the strain-rate tensor on the surface of deforming bodies, and on a 'lifted' surface in simulations involving rigid objects. We present results for benchmark flows demonstrating that we can obtain an accurate distribution of flow-induced surface-forces. The capabilities of our method are demonstrated using simulations of self-propelled swimmers, where we obtain the pressure and shear distribution on their deforming surfaces

    Self-gravitational Magnetohydrodynamics with Adaptive Mesh Refinement for Protostellar Collapse

    Get PDF
    A new numerical code, called SFUMATO, for solving self-gravitational magnetohydrodynamics (MHD) problems using adaptive mesh refinement (AMR) is presented. A block-structured grid is adopted as the grid of the AMR hierarchy. The total variation diminishing (TVD) cell-centered scheme is adopted as the MHD solver, with hyperbolic cleaning of divergence error of the magnetic field also implemented. The self-gravity is solved by a multigrid method composed of (1) full multigrid (FMG)-cycle on the AMR hierarchical grids, (2) V-cycle on these grids, and (3) FMG-cycle on the base grid. The multigrid method exhibits spatial second-order accuracy, fast convergence, and scalability. The numerical fluxes are conserved by using a refluxing procedure in both the MHD solver and the multigrid method. The several tests are performed indicating that the solutions are consistent with previously published results.Comment: 23 pages, 15 figures. PASJ in press. Document with high resolution figures is available in http://redmagic.i.hosei.ac.jp/~matsu/AMR06/matsumotoAMR.pd

    Variational optic flow computation in real-time

    Get PDF
    Variational methods for optic flow computation have the reputation of producing good results at the expense of being too slow for realtime applications. We show that real-time variational computation of optic flow fields is possible when appropriate methods are combined with modern numerical techniques. We consider the CLG method, a recent variational technique that combines the quality of the dense flow fields of the Horn and Schunck approach with the noise robustness of the Lucas-Kanade method. For the linear system of equations resulting from the discretised Euler-Lagrange equations, we present different multigrid schemes in detail. We show that under realistic accuracy requirements they are up to 247 times more efficient than the widely used GauĂź-Seidel algorithm. On a 3.06 GHz PC, we have computed 40 dense flow fields of size 200 x 200 pixels within a single second
    • …
    corecore